Every year, SARI chooses a Rider Ambassador from our participants to help us showcase the work we do.
Our Rider Ambassador usually attends events with their family or caregiver to help demonstrate the impact that SARI’s work can have on our participants’ lives.
Sarah has been coming to SARI for over 20 years, and is one of our long-running participants. During her time at SARI, Sarah has shown immense improvements in areas such as self-confidence, independence, and in understanding how her actions and emotions impact her horse.
"SARI has meant so much more to Sarah than just the riding, which she loves! The program has positively supported the development of her communication and independence skills through the years. Just as important is the community of volunteers, staff, and riders and their families that she belongs to and feels so proud to be a part of!"
Andrea, Sarah's mom
Sarah is familiar with our entire herd, but has most recently connected with Rowan. During their sessions, Rowan challenges Sarah to be confident and clear in her communication, and also to work on her relaxation techniques in the saddle.
